设为首页收藏本站

Scripts 学盟

 找回密码
 加入学盟

QQ登录

只需一步,快速开始

查看: 1671|回复: 3
打印 上一主题 下一主题

LIKE 查询时,如何转义 [复制链接]

管理员

超级大菜鸟

Rank: 9Rank: 9Rank: 9

跳转到指定楼层
1#
50金钱
比如 myTab

idtext
1abc
2a%c
  1. -- mysql
  2. -- 想查出 text 带有 % 的记录

  3. SELECT * FROM myTAB WHERE `text` LIKE '%%%'; -- 这可怎么写
复制代码

最佳答案

分享到: Q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
分享分享0 收藏收藏0

Rank: 7Rank: 7Rank: 7

2#
俊俊 实名认证  发表于 2011-9-23 09:30:22 |只看该作者
本帖最后由 俊俊 于 2011-9-23 09:44 编辑
  1. SELECT * FROM myTAB WHERE 'text' LIKE '%\%%';
复制代码

使用道具 举报

管理员

超级大菜鸟

Rank: 9Rank: 9Rank: 9

3#
混混@普宁.中国 实名认证  发表于 2011-9-23 10:03:52 |只看该作者
mysql 测试通过

使用道具 举报

Rank: 8Rank: 8

4#
那个谁 发表于 2011-9-23 10:36:18 |只看该作者
本帖最后由 那个谁 于 2011-9-23 11:01 编辑
混混@普宁.中国 发表于 2011-9-23 10:03
mysql 测试通过


这样也可以 `%`    这个是错误的

使用道具 举报

您需要登录后才可以回帖 登录 | 加入学盟

手机版|Scripts 学盟   |

GMT+8, 2024-12-19 11:07 , Processed in 1.123236 second(s), 14 queries .

Powered by Discuz! X2

© 2001-2011 Comsenz Inc.

回顶部